What is Cummins Insite Software?

Cummins Insite is a PC-based diagnostic tool designed specifically for Cummins engines. Developed by Cummins Inc., this software allows technicians to interface directly with the engine’s ECM (Electronic Control Module) using a compatible data link adapter. Insite reads fault codes, monitors system parameters, runs tests, and even reprograms or updates engine calibrations.

Insite is widely used in both independent repair shops and fleet service centers because it provides OEM-level access to the inner workings of a Cummins-powered engine.

Key Capabilities of Cummins Insite

  • Read and clear active/inactive fault codes

  • Monitor live engine data such as RPM, pressure, and temperature

  • Perform functional tests (e.g., injector cutout, turbo actuator testing)

  • Update or recalibrate the ECM with official Cummins files

  • Generate trip reports and maintenance logs

Getting Started: What You Need to Use Cummins Insite

Setting up Cummins Insite requires a few pieces of essential hardware and software.

Hardware Requirements

  • A Windows-based PC or laptop

  • A data link adapter (e.g., Cummins INLINE 7, Nexiq USB-Link, DG Tech DPA)

  • Vehicle connection cables (J1939, J1708, or OBD-II depending on model)

Software Options

Cummins Insite comes in two main versions:

  • Insite Lite: Provides basic functions like reading fault codes and viewing data.

  • Insite Pro: Offers full access to all diagnostic tools, calibrations, and tests.

Insite Pro is recommended for professional technicians due to its advanced capabilities.

Additional Resources

  • Cummins UpdateManager: Used to keep Insite and calibration files up to date.

  • Cummins QuickServe Online: Offers access to repair manuals, wiring diagrams, and fault code details.

Common Tasks Technicians Perform Using Cummins Insite

Understanding how Insite is used in real-world scenarios helps technicians become more comfortable with the software.

Fault Code Troubleshooting

Insite not only identifies fault codes but also provides a structured approach to resolving them. Each code includes:

  • A description of the issue

  • Possible causes

  • Suggested diagnostic steps

  • Relevant component locations

Injector Cutout Test

Technicians can use this feature to isolate misfiring cylinders. By temporarily disabling injectors one at a time, you can determine which cylinder is causing performance issues.

Turbo Actuator Calibration

If a turbo actuator is replaced or suspected of malfunctioning, Insite allows you to run a test or recalibration. This ensures proper boost pressure and prevents engine derating.

ECM Programming

For updated calibrations or replacement ECMs, Insite Pro lets you download the latest software directly from Cummins and reflash the control module—ensuring optimal performance and compliance.
